Frequently Asked Questions
Which shell types does this adapter support?
The FSA 386 EVO adapter is offered in variants to suit BB86 (86.5 mm) shells and PF30/BB30 shells. It requires your frame to have BB30 or PF30-style 30mm bearings already installed. Verify your shell width and bearing type before purchasing.
Do I need special tools to install the adapter?
No specialized tools are required beyond standard crank installation tools and a torque wrench. Light grease on the adapter contact faces is recommended. If you're unfamiliar with press-fit bearings or crank preload procedures, have a shop install it to ensure correct alignment and torque.
Will this adapter affect bearing life or crank performance?
When matched with correctly installed 30mm bearings and the appropriate shell variant, the adapter preserves bearing alignment and crank function. Proper seating and torqueing are important—misalignment or improper preload can cause premature wear, so follow crank and frame manufacturer recommendations.
Can I use this to run a 386 EVO crank on an older BB30 frame?
Yes—if your BB30 frame uses 30mm bearings, the PF30/BB30 variant will adapt the shell to accept an FSA 386 EVO crankset. Confirm the bearing type and shell width before ordering to ensure compatibility.
Is the adapter compatible with non-FSA cranks that use a 30mm spindle?
The adapter is designed specifically to provide the correct seating for FSA 386 EVO crank geometry. While some 30mm-spindle cranks may physically fit, differences in spindle shoulder dimensions and preload systems can affect performance; compatibility is not guaranteed with non-FSA cranks.
What maintenance does the adapter require?
Maintenance is minimal—inspect for corrosion or damage during routine drivetrain service, re-grease contact faces if you remove the crank, and ensure bearings remain properly seated. The anodized finish reduces corrosion risk compared with bare aluminum.
Buying Guide
When buying a bottom bracket adapter, the two most important factors are shell compatibility (type and width) and bearing inner diameter. Choose the variant that matches your frame: BB86 (86.5mm) for frames that use the BB86 press-fit standard, or PF30/BB30 for frames that use 30mm bearings. Ensure your crankset spindle diameter is 30mm—this adapter is engineered specifically for FSA 386 EVO crank geometry. Also consider condition of existing bearings; replacing worn bearings when fitting the adapter will prolong service life and prevent creaks. If you ride frequently on rough roads or gravel, pay attention to seal quality and correct preload torque to protect bearings and maintain smooth pedaling performance.
